1. The Origins of Wine Jokes

Wine jokes have a long and rich history, dating back to ancient civilizations where wine was not just a drink but a significant part of culture and social gatherings. The humor surrounding wine can be traced to the early Greeks and Romans, who often celebrated their love for wine through storytelling, poetry, and humor.

As wine became a staple across Europe and later the world, so did the jokes that accompanied it. Over time, wine jokes evolved into a form of social commentary, poking fun at the pretentiousness often associated with wine connoisseurs. Today, wine jokes continue to entertain and amuse, bridging the gap between casual drinkers and serious sommeliers.
